Шаг 5 из 9

Task Definitions

Отлично! Кластер создан. Теперь у нас есть площадка для запуска luigi-задач.

Перед тем как запустить luigi-задачу, её необходимо описать. Под описанием я подразумеваю, что необходимо задать какой контейнер использовать, его характеристики (оперативная память, CPU). Для этих целей в ECS есть т.н. Task Definitions.

Нажимайте на Create new Task Definition, далее выбирайте тип запуска Fargate.

В разделе Configure task and container definitions необходимо задать название Task Definition — luigiTask, выбрать роль запуска ecsTaskExecutionRole.

Что касается характеристик для контейнера, можно для начала использовать 1 Гб оперативной памяти и 0.5 vCPU. Далее необходимо добавить докер-образ, нажимаем на Add container.

Этого достаточно, чтобы создать первый Task Definition.

Комментарии